Prévia do material em texto
Prefira expressões claras em vez de otimizações prematuras
Priorize a clareza sobre a complexidade desnecessária.
❌ Exemplo ruim:
javascript
Copiar código
const result = arr.reduce((acc, cur) => (cur > acc ? cur : acc), -Infinity);
✔ Exemplo bom:
javascript
Copiar código
function findMax(arr) {
let max = -Infinity;
for (const num of arr) {
if (num > max) {
max = num;
}
}
return max;
}